2.5 stars

Well, this was different. I didn't hate it, but I didn't love it either. The Toy Sorcerer is an original story that has a Alice in Wonderland-vibe to it. Too bad I was never a fan of that story, but I kind of liked this version of it. The story is well-crafted and it's written pretty good too, but I had a hard time getting through it. I had to force myself to continue reading the book. Once I was reading I got through it pretty quick but I don't like it when I have to force myself to read it. I read it because I had to finish it. I postponed reading it a lot and that's never good.

What I liked:
The plot is pretty original. I loved the characters. Especially Shammy. He's so fun! I also liked the world the writer has created in this book. The Dream Realms are exciting and scary at the same time.

What I didn't like:
Well... the fact that I didn't want to read it further and had to force myself doing so, can be because this just isn't my cup of tea. That doesn't mean this story is bad, because it isn't. It's pretty good, but not everybody likes the same things. Something that really annoyed me throughout the book are the occasional spelling and grammar errors I found. And the fact that a girl from Belgium, who's native language isn't English but Dutch, can find these errors, isn't a good sign. So, yeah. That annoyed me. xD

My conclusion:
Although it's not one of my favorites, once I was reading I enjoyed reading it. I wasn't hooked to the story, so yeah. I will be reading the sequel, maybe the things I didn't like in this part, will be better in the next. I have to read 3 other books first, but I will get to it soon enough.
